21xrx.com
2024-11-05 16:31:14 Tuesday
登录
文章检索 我的文章 写文章
C++和C#的难度比较
2023-07-08 18:35:33 深夜i     --     --
C++ C# 比较 难度 编程语言

C++和C#是现代编程中常见的两种编程语言,两者都有其优势和劣势,同时也存在着难度上的不同。

C++语言作为一种结构化编程语言,其使用也非常广泛,承载着很多大型项目,在一些电子设备、嵌入式系统中占据重要地位,更多地被学生所学习。C++语言的难度也相对更高一些,因为它的语法和功能相对更加复杂,需要更高的的技术水平才能使用它来开发软件。同时,C++在内存管理以及指针使用上也需要程序员具备更高的技术能力。

C#语言,与C++相比起来,较为年轻,它是一门面向对象的高级编程语言,具有更好的可读性和扩展性。由于其易于使用的特点,C#语言更多被新手程序员所学习和使用。但是,C#也有其缺点,首先,它必须在Windows系统中运行,并且其运行速度也相对较慢。其次,虽然C#语言的可读性更强,但这也导致了其代码量通常会比较大一些,需要花费更多的时间来编写、测试和维护代码。

总而言之,C++和C#两者有各自的优势和局限性。简单的说,C++的难度略高于C#,但也能够提供更高的性能和更强的控制力;C#则相对简单,但是软件开发的效率和运行速度相对较低。因此,在开发需要高性能和可控性的项目时,程序员更倾向于C++,而在开发简单应用或跨平台开发时,则更多地使用C#。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复